The Eine Lustspielouvertüre (Comedy Overture) Op. 38 (BV 245) for orchestra is a concert overture by Ferruccio Busoni; it was composed in 1897 and revised in 1904. The main theme appears at once, played by the strings. The second subject follows on clarinet. A new section introduces the development. In recapitulation the second theme is reworked for the cellos and contrabasses over a timpani pedal point. The work ends with a lively coda.
